Food packaging safety on the edge of the wave playback on November 22, 2005, the world famous food company Nestle food group of Switzerland was recalled a batch of baby milk in four European countries - France, Portugal, Spain and Italy. The reason is that during the sampling inspection of a batch of baby milk sold by Nestle group in Italy a few days ago, it was found that the UV printing ink of this batch of milk packaging materials contained a chemical substance called isopropylthiotonone (itx), which had penetrated into the milk

in November 2005, the Italian authorities confiscated thousands of liters of Nestle's baby milk, and the court ordered Nestle to recall a total of 2million liters of milk from its two Italian brands, nidina and latte Mio, making the itx incident the front page headlines of various media. In an instant, the spearhead pointed, and there was a sound of doubt

now, EFSA (European Food Safety Agency) has issued a statement on the itx incident. EFSA said that the presence of itx in food is not welcome, but according to the reported level of use, it will not threaten the health of consumers. So far, the itx storm has come to an end

domestic and foreign regulations on the safety of food packaging materials

abroad, countries and alliance organizations all over the world have made relevant management regulations on the safety of food packaging materials

in 2005, the EU strictly limited the content of heavy metals in packaging products in the current 94/62/EC regulation. Among them, the most stringent regulations are lead, cadmium, mercury and hexavalent chromium. It also explains in detail the detection methods and calculation methods of these four heavy metals. Taking a mineral water bottle as an example, it can be divided into three parts: bottle body, bottle cap and label. The content of lead, cadmium, mercury and hexavalent chromium in these three parts can not exceed 100ppm

because adhesives and inks in food packaging may contain harmful substances such as formaldehyde, benzene, toluene, xylene and methanol. The United States and the European Union have clearly stipulated in relevant laws that the type of adhesive and ink b1.01 used for food or drug packaging is prohibited as long as it is a chemical not mentioned in the regulations

recently, Germany has put forward new requirements for the packaging cartons used for Chinese exported food, requiring that the cartons should be sealed with glue as much as possible, and PVC or other plastic tapes should not be used. If plastic tapes have to be used, they must also be PE/Pb free tapes

not long ago, the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) released a document entitled "key points for the application of recycled plastics in food packaging - Chemical concerns". The document evaluates the various applications of recycled plastics in food packaging, emphasizes the problems needing attention in the application of such products, and clearly stipulates the precautions for the application of recycled plastics in food packaging

in China, the safety of food packaging materials is not calm

on May 26, 2005, the general guidelines for green food packaging was officially issued, which clearly stipulates that expanded polystyrene, polyurethane and other products are not allowed for plastic products

on September 6, 2005, the Symposium on the hygiene and safety of plastic food packaging materials was held, and the quality and hygiene of food packaging was raised to an important level

on May 10, 2005, the notice on the revision of the implementation rules of safety and environmental protection certification was hung on the station of the bid winning Certification Center. Among them, the "rules for the implementation of food packaging/container products - plastic products" ranks first. Its final revised version will be issued by the national certification and Accreditation Administration as the implementation rules of the national 3C certification (compulsory concurrent product certification management system) of this kind of products

We must be soberly aware that the safety situation of food plastic packaging in China is very serious, and many food plastic packaging materials on the market are difficult to meet the national requirements for food safety, health and environmental protection

of course, the reason for the current situation is also related to our country's management of the industry. For example, enterprises engaged in food plastic packaging have not been included in the scope of food industry health management, resulting in the absence of some clear regulations and controls on health and safety in the production of plastic materials for food packaging by these enterprises; The industry has not established an authoritative monitoring system and health and safety project detection system, thus ignoring some potentially harmful substances, such as heavy metals such as lead, mercury, cadmium, hexavalent chromium, and carcinogens in oxides, pigments, and fuels in ink binders. In addition, there are many standard testing methods that are out of line with production, cannot be refined and lack pertinence. For example, at present, the solvent residue in food packaging plastic materials in China is required to be less than 10mg/m2, but it is not clear what kind of solvent it is
